Match Report
Gritty display!
The Rovers produced another good performance on a really difficult day for playing football with a strong wind and a poor pitch. Mateo opened the scoring by seizing on the rebound from his earlier effort and rocketing the ball into the bottom corner, his first goal of the season. Jack O doubled our lead by following up on a rebound from the keeper and smartly placing the ball into the net and from then on it was a matter of how many? First Ollie and then Jack G ensured joy in the Goodin house by extending our lead to 4-0 at half time.
The second half saw us play more flowing football and alhough we added three more goals from Jack G and Bradley (2) it could have been many more with the "hitting the woodwork" count more than 5 and their goalie having a great game to deny Brads, Ollie, James, Jack and Ish and Jack M having one disallowed. Jack O pleased his manager by pulling off a "spin and run" throw (one from training!) and Max danced in goal to keep warm.
MOTM - Mateo. Intelligent use of the ball in the first half and a great goal to get off the mark for the season.
